Prayer of Nigeria saved Mr. President - Pastor whose pre-election prophecy about Buhari failed defends himself

Earlier, before the conduction of the 2019 presidential election, a prophet named Samuel Akinbodunse prophesied that if Buhari tried to seek a second term as president, he would die before the elections take place. The acclaimed man of God who is based in South Africa was vehement in his claim.

However, it would seem that despite the seeming surety of his claim, Muhammadu Buhari did not only seek a second term, he also went on to be eventually re-elected. It would be recalled that he said a young person whose name starts with S would win the election instead.

After the victory of Buhari, the prophet who had made a strong prophecy on Buhari's death took to defending himself and excusing the clear fact that his claim had failed to come to pass.

In a conversation with a media house, he stood on his ground that the prophecy had been true. However, the man said that the prayers of some men of God had helped sustain the current president of Nigeria.

According to him, the prayers of Nigeria for the president had also been instrumental in keeping him safe from evil. Samuel went on to say that he and some men of God had organises 40 days fasting and praying just so they could reverse the prophecy. He went on to quote a scriptural passage to defend his claim.

The Transitional Phase of African Poetry

The Transitional Phase The second phase, which we have chosen to call transitional, is represented by the poetry of writers like Abioseh Nicol, Gabriel Okara, Kwesi Brew, Dennis Brutus, Lenrie Peters and Joseph Kariuki. This is poetry which is written by people we normally refer to as modem and who may be thought of as belonging to the third phase. The characteristics of this poetry are its competent and articulate use of the received European language, its unforced grasp of Africa’s physical, cultural and socio-political environment and often its lyricism. To distinguish this type of poetry we have to refer back to the concept of appropriation we introduced earlier. At the simplest and basic level, the cultural mandate of possessing a people’s piece of the earth involves a mental and emotional homecoming within the physical environment.
